BAD_POOL_CALLER (c2)
The current thread is making a bad pool request. Typically this is at a bad IRQL level or double freeing the same allocation, etc.
Arguments:
Arg1: 0000000000000007, Attempt to free pool which was already freed
Arg2: 000000000000110b, (reserved)
Arg3: 00000000042b0008, Memory contents of the pool block
Arg4: fffffa8005ca8d60, Address of the block of pool being deallocated
